I am currently working in using the HTML5 audio player to provide a audio stream (24/7 radio stream) via the (mobile) browser. Loading in the stream and playing it works fine.

The major problem is that the HTML5 <audio> tag will keep downloading (buffering) content even when its not active. This could be a major issue for mobile users since most of them pay for data use. So far I have not been able to find a decent solutions that works cross browser to prevent this.

I tried so far:

  1. Unload the source when pause is pressed. < This does not work cross browser
  2. Remove the audio player element and load a new one. This works but
    lets be honest, this is a very hacky way of performing an extremely
    simple task.

I was simply wondering if there is something I’m overlooking in this whole issue since I am convinced I’m not the only one with this issue.
